Share the same jpa entity name

Webb31 mars 2024 · JTA - Java Transaction API - is an API for managing transactions in Java. It has a few crucial steps according to the transaction life-cycle. Transaction synchronization - the process in which transactions becomes registered in a persistence context. Transaction association - the moment of persistence context connecting with transaction. Webb29 juni 2024 · jpa entity 사용시 테이블 명을 중복으로 사용하는 경우 에러가 발생된다. 아래 에러 셈플을 기준으로 @Entity(name = "CONTENT_COLOR")를 ContentColor, ContentLink . 두 entity 에서 동시에 사용하고 있다는 뜻이다.

Getting Started Accessing Data with JPA - Spring

WebbWhen two entity classes in different packages share the same class name, explicit entity name setting is required to avoid clashes. Mapped Superclasses In JPA, classes that are … Webb7 juli 2024 · org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'entityManagerFactory' defined in class path resource … first wedding dance lessons https://kingmecollective.com

Chapter 2. Mapping Entities - JBoss

Webb7 juli 2024 · Defining the JPA Entities. Our model domain consists of three JPA entities: User, Author, Book and I recommend placing all your entities in the same package, e.g. com. mapstruct. demo. entities. You can be defined them as follows: @Getter @Setter @Entity @Table (name = "user") public class User {@Id @GeneratedValue (strategy = … Each JPA entity must have a primary key that uniquely identifies it. The @Id annotation defines the primary key. We can generate the identifiers in different ways, which are specified by the @GeneratedValueannotation. We can choose from four id generation strategies with the strategy element. The value can be … Visa mer Let's say we have a POJO called Student, which represents the data of a student, and we would like to store it in the database: In order to do this, we should define an entity so that JPA is aware of it. So let's define it by … Visa mer Just like the @Table annotation, we can use the @Columnannotation to mention the details of a column in the table. The @Column annotation … Visa mer In most cases, the name of the table in the database and the name of the entity won't be the same. In these cases, we can specify the table name using the @Tableannotation: We can also mention the schema using the … Visa mer Sometimes, we may want to make a field non-persistent. We can use the @Transientannotation to do so. It specifies that the field won't be persisted. For instance, we can … Visa mer WebbIs there any way to do that with JPA or Hibernate? Solution: Yes, you can map an entity to 2 database tables in 2 simple steps: You need to annotate your entity with JPA’s @Table and @SecondaryTable annotations and provide the names of the first and second table as the value of the name parameters. first wedding dress fitting

Spring: Win32_Session class

Category:JPA Annotations - Hibernate Annotations DigitalOcean

Tags:Share the same jpa entity name

Share the same jpa entity name

[Solved]-Select a default Entity when two or more Entities with …

Webb10 apr. 2024 · One-to-One Relationship in JPA. The right tools can and will save a lot of time. As long as you are using Hibernate and IntelliJ IDEA you can boost your coding … Webb7 apr. 2024 · Check if you have any dependencies in your project that define an entity with the same name. You can try excluding those dependencies from your project or …

Share the same jpa entity name

Did you know?

Webb6 apr. 2024 · 1. Overview. This article is about to delete query in Spring Data JPA or we can say how to delete records using spring JPA in SQL as well as No-SQL database. There are multiple to ways the query to delete records from the database, We have explained here delete using Derivation Mechanism, @Query annotation, @Query with nativeQuery as … Webb4 aug. 2024 · 인프런에서 공부하다가 위 블로그와 같은 증상이 나타났다. [ entities share the same JPA entity name] 해결법으로 제시한 인텔리제이 캐시삭제를 해도 증상이 사라지지 않았다. 인텔리제이 파일메뉴. 그래서 캐시삭제 대신에 그 위에 있는 Repair IDE를 클릭해서 모든 action를 ...

Webb5 sep. 2024 · 1. Introduction. Spring Data JPA offers many features to use JPA in an application. Among those features, there's the standardization of table and column … Webb9 apr. 2024 · So check persistence name in both code and XML file carefully - ensure that they are the same. 2. Typos in name of JPA config file The name of JPA config file must be persistence.xml, but somehow you name it slightly different, e.g. peristence.xml - a letter s is missing. So check typos in file name to make sure it is persistence.xml exactly. 3.

WebbIf you want to map the same database table to two entities, you should create a simple inheritance hierarchy. The superclass should be abstract and contain all attributes that … Webb26 nov. 2024 · As straightforward as it might be in a relational database, when it comes to JPA, the one-to-many database association can be represented either through a …

WebbIn EJB 3.0, you can implement a named query using metadata (see "Implementing a JPA Named Query"), and then create and execute the query by name at run time (see "Creating a Named Query With the EntityManager"). OC4J supports both Java persistence query language and native SQL named queries.

Webb24 mars 2024 · Entities share the same JPA entity name 에러. SOO- 2024. 3. 24. 05:33. org.springframework.beans.factory.BeanCreationException: Error creating bean with … camping cooler food checklistWebb@Override public void addEntityBinding(PersistentClass persistentClass) throws DuplicateMappingException { final String entityName = persistentClass.getEntityName(); … first wedding in the metaverseWebb14 apr. 2024 · You might have used it on the Student.user mapping instead of MapsId so that JPA would know the foreign key in the mapping is tied to the id property - but JPA would NOT set the id property for you. It would behave as if you set a joinColumn and specified the same ID column and marked it updatable=false, insertable=false. – first wedding gift ideasWebb26 mars 2024 · Embedded - A reference to a object that shares the same table of the parent. ElementCollection - JPA 2.0, a Collection or Map of Basic or Embeddable objects, stored in a separate table. This covers the majority of types of relationships that exist in most object models. camping coolers for saleWebb6 nov. 2024 · Entities share the same JPA entity name: [project] which is not allowed!** 换成 @Data @Entity(name = "project") public class ProjectAEntity extends BaseEntity { ... camping coos bay oregon coastWebb28 nov. 2024 · Entities share the same JPA entity name: [project] which is not allowed! 换成 @Data @Entity(name = "project") public class ProjectAEntity extends BaseEntity { ... first wednesday connect cbrinWebb13 mars 2014 · There are few entities have same names such as @Entity(name="myentity1"). I am getting error at deployment "Entity name must be … first wedgie hanging